Arizona Land Consulting acquired 956 acres in Tonopah for $25 million to prepare for future data center development.
Arizona Land Consulting has expanded its footprint in the far West Valley with the acquisition of 956 acres in Tonopah. CEO Anita Verma-Lallian confirmed the land was purchased for $25 million on May 20, with plans to utilize the site for future data center campus developments.
TSMC is developing a $165 billion gigafab campus in Phoenix, while Amkor Technology constructs a $7-billion packaging and testing facility in Peoria to anchor Arizona's semiconductor growth.
Prime Data Centers has broken ground on three 267,000-square-foot buildings at its $3 billion, 1.3 million-square-foot PHX01 campus in Avondale.
